David Ross Stuebing

1942 – 2025

It is with heavy hearts that we announce the passing of David “Dave” Ross Stuebing, who died peacefully at the Waterloo Regional Health Network (WRHN) @ Midtown on Sunday, June 8th, 2025, at the age of 83, surrounded by his loving family.

 Born and raised in Kitchener, Dave dedicated nearly 40 years of his life to the skilled trades as a journeyman pipefitter and sprinkler fitter. Proud owner and operator of Hillcrest Sprinkler Services for the majority of his career, he took immense satisfaction in mentoring countless apprentices, sharing his expertise and unwavering work ethic often expressed as “if a job is worth doing, it’s worth doing well”. 

 Dave was a dedicated provider and family man with a deep faith. He expressed his faith through service to his church community, first as an Elder at Hope Lutheran and later as a Deacon at Northside Community. Those who know him will recall his cheerful whistle, willingness to have a friendly debate about politics, and roll up his sleeves to help whenever it was needed. He found joy in playing board games with family and friends. He loved to garden, cultivating blooms and trimming hedges to be at their best, at home and at the church. He was frugal but exceedingly generous, never letting anyone pay for dinner if he could help it. Above all, Dave was a devoted husband, father, grandfather, great-grandfather, brother, and friend.  He will be missed more than words can express.

 He leaves behind his beloved wife and best friend of over 60 years, Sharon Emily (née Moore). Together they made their home first in Bridgeport and, for the past 11 years, in the vibrant Fallowfield complex.

 Dave is survived by his sons Kenneth William (and his wife Pamela née McMillan) and Dennis Lawrence (and his partner Ian Jefferson), his grandchildren Justin Michael (and his partner Stephanie Shantz) and Brandon Kyle (and his partner Jasmine Van de Laar), and his great-grandchildren Araiyah and Ezran. He is also remembered by his brother Larry (Karen), his brother Jim (Sandra), and his sister-in-law Shirley.

 He was predeceased by his parents, John and Laura (née Horst); his brothers Bruce, Charles, and Edward, and his sister Sharyn.
